Zoox is developing the first ground-up, fully autonomous vehicle fleet and the supporting ecosystem required to bring this technology to market. Sitting at the intersection of robotics, machine learning, and design, Zoox aims to provide the next generation of mobility-as-a-service in urban environments. We’re looking for top talent that shares our passion and wants to be part of a fast-moving and highly execution-oriented team. As the Senior Technical Program Manager (TPM) for Vehicle Attributes, you will be the operational engine and technical coordinator behind vehicle attribute development (NVH, sound and voice, ride and handling, etc.). Partnering with a world-class team of robotics, controls, and vehicle engineers, you won’t just track status - you will anticipate risks, engineer frameworks that optimize development velocity, and bridge the gap between complex engineering and executive strategy.
